Gov't to continue Lee Bo case

January 26, 2016

The Police have sent another letter to the Guangdong Public Security Department requesting a meeting with bookseller Lee Bo, Chief Executive CY Leung says.

 

Speaking to reporters ahead of an Executive Council meeting this morning, Mr Leung noted that the Police were informed by Mrs Lee on January 23 that she had met with her husband on the Mainland that day.

 

He added that the development was announced in a Police press release issued at 2am on January 24 and that officers had sent another written request to Guangdong authorities for a meeting with Mr Lee.

 

The Chief Executive reiterated that there have been cases in which Hong Kong has requested assistance from Mainland authorities when they have taken even longer to reply than for Mr Lee's case.

 

The Government will continue to follow up on the case, he added.
